Reggae Night – The Rivertones Perform the hits of Bob Marley, UB40 and Eddy Grant
The Rivertones
Live Music
8 December 16h00 |Tickets cost R200 / R180
This is an exceptional show with Cape Town’s most loved reggae band, The Rivertones, performing the hits of reggae legends such as Bob Marley, UB40 and Eddy Grant, as well as some of their own their originals too. The band had the honour of supporting Ali Campbell’s UB40 during their South African tour in 2023. Reggae music, a treasured cultural export from Jamaica, has served as a unifying force among diverse cultural groups in Cape Town, with The Rivertones at the forefront of this movement. The Rivertones’ performance features Bob Marley reggae classics such as “One Love,” “Is This Love,” “No Woman No Cry,” “Buffalo Soldier,” and “Could You Be Loved.” They also deliver popular UB40 hits like “Kingston Town,” “Red Red Wine,” “Can’t Help Falling In Love,” and Eddy Grant songs like “Electric Avenue,” “I Don’t Wanna Dance,” “Do You Feel My Love,” and “Hope Jo’anna,” along with other reggae favourites.

Doep Is Nie Dood Nie
Jannie du Toit Susan Mouton – tjello Chanie Jonker – klavier en akkordeon
Cabaret
17 December 19h30 |Tickets cost R200 / R180
Hierdie program, saamgestel uit Koos du Plessis se onsterflike liedjies asook van sy gedigte en tekste, is ’n herwaardering van sy werk en stel ook van sy minder bekende materiaal bekend. Veertig jaar na sy afsterwe (in 2024) word dit duidelik hoe lewend en relevant sy siening van die lewe steeds bly, hoe treffend sy liedkuns. Jannie du Toit, ’n groot vriend van Du Plessis, sit hiermee sy werk voort om Koos se musiek by ’n volgende geslag te laat voortleef. Hy verwesenlik ook ’n jarelange droom om ’n “eenmanvertoning” oor Koos se werk aan te bied.
